I want to move a door, but a heating duct runs through the space where I want to put the door. The heating duct is for a forced hot air furnace. It is passing straight up through two floors to a finished third floor. Can I rerout the duct or should I cap it and put electric baseboard heating on the third floor? Moving the door to another location won't work.
